Jack Brake, JS '18, wins a Schwarzman Scholarship to pursue graduate studies in China

December 5, 2017

Jack Brake, the C.D.L. and M.T.B. Perkins Jefferson Scholar, is one of 142 students across the world to be named a Schwarzman Scholar. Designed to prepare the next generation of global leaders, the Schwarzman Scholarship was established in 2016, offering recipients the opportunity to pursue a one-year Master’s Degree at Tsinghua University in Beijing, one of China’s most prestigious universities. Jack emerged from a highly competitive pool of more than 4,000 applicants.

Jack looks forward to joining the third class of Schwarzman Scholars and to learning more about China and international politics in East Asia before coming back to the United States to pursue a Ph.D. Jack is the second Jefferson Scholar to receive a Schwarzman Scholarship. Ben Harris, the David J. Wood Jefferson Scholar, joined the inaugural class in 2016.
